Jackson is 6 years old and the youngest of the Faulkenberry clan. Jackson loves anything Cars (the movie and actual cars), swimming, and playing with his brothers, Michael and Lucas, and his “sissy” Sammi. You might be wondering what is Down syndrome? Down syndrome is when a person has 47 chromosomes (the things inside us that decide how we will grow, act and if we will look like mom or dad) instead of the usual 46 chromosomes. We like to think of it as Jackson got just a little something extra when God made him! Down syndrome isn’t a disease and you can’t “catch it” (although, if you could catch Down syndrome, it would probably just make you smile more).

Down syndrome makes Jackson look a bit different than other people. You might notice that he’s much shorter than kids his age and he has a flatter nose and smaller ears. Down syndrome also makes it hard for Jackson to talk and he is often difficult to understand. Jackson understands everything other people say to him or around him, but he has trouble answering like you and I would. To help others understand him, Jackson not only talks, but uses sign language for some words that are especially hard for him to say. Jackson also has trouble doing some physical activities because of his Down syndrome because his muscles can be weak. Fortunately, swim is easier than some sports for Jackson to do with his weaker muscles (and he LOVES it)!!
